Transaction b21be77b6175a55d41e8558e2415f64b792e7941b269304092c74fbb5989f59d

2 Input
2 Outputs
  • b21be77b6175a55d41e8558e2415f64b792e7941b269304092c74fbb5989f59d:0
  • value  597000000
    address  13R32dfgePYmoDC4eF2HtscQcBjWxvPTTN
  • b21be77b6175a55d41e8558e2415f64b792e7941b269304092c74fbb5989f59d:1
  • value  506854947
    address  1Nmuda5rSXqfCBMtx77gmRe2fHcqEK48Uu